Critical Evaluation
The interview provides a valuable, expert-level overview of modern database architecture, specifically the FDAP stack. Andrew Lamb’s credentials as a staff engineer at InfluxData and PMC member of Apache DataFusion and Arrow lend significant authority to the discussion. The content is technically accurate and reflects current best practices in the field, such as columnar storage and the use of standardized components. The argumentation is coherent, moving from the historical context of database evolution to the specific components of the FDAP stack and their roles. The discussion is well-structured, with clear explanations of each technology and its purpose. The sources cited, including the InfluxData blog post and the CIDR paper, are relevant and credible, though the interview itself is not a formal scientific presentation. The title accurately reflects the content, and the interview delivers on its promise. The main strength is the practical insight from someone who has built a database using these components, providing a real-world perspective. The main limitation is the interview format, which may lack the depth of a technical paper, but it serves as an excellent introduction to the topic. Overall, the information is reliable and well-presented, making it a valuable resource for developers and data engineers interested in modern database design.

Contribution & Novelties
The interview provides a clear, practitioner-oriented explanation of the FDAP stack, emphasizing the benefits of assembling databases from standardized open-source components. It highlights how this approach reduces development time and improves interoperability. The discussion of columnar storage and the roles of Arrow, Parquet, DataFusion, and Flight is insightful for developers considering building their own data systems.
